Water-Wise Rain Garden Options

Rain gardens are a brilliant solution for managing stormwater while creating a dynamic landscape feature in Maple Valley, WA. Designed by a certified landscaping contractor, these shallow, planted basins filter runoff from roofs and driveways, reducing erosion and pollution. Using native plants and engineered soil drainage solutions, they turn heavy rainfall into a sustainable part of your yard’s design.

  • Design rain gardens near downspouts or low yard areas
  • Incorporate water-loving natives like willows
  • Contribute to local watershed health with eco-friendly yard choices

Watering Network Winterization

Properly shutting down your irrigation system prevents costly freeze damage each year. A certified technician uses compressed air to drain valves before the first hard frost. Skipping this step risks foundation issues—especially in Maple Valley’s fluctuating temps. Schedule this protective task in late fall.

Continuous Grass Advice

Keeping your lawn lush in the moist environment means adapting care by season. Overseed in autumn to combat compaction and moss. Use slow-release fertilizers and avoid overwatering—our region’s rainfall often reduces the need. For eco-conscious spaces, consider alternatives like fine fescue.

  • Mow high to shade roots
  • Water deeply but infrequently to build resilient turf
  • Test soil annually based on usage patterns
